School Council

Our School Council is made up of two elected members from each class who meet regularly with Mrs Witheyman and Miss Whitwood, and to lead discussions in their classes about important issues. These could be concerns children or adults have raised; ideas for improvements that could be made; recognition of what we are doing well; ideas for fundraising.
